Across TCGA patient cohorts, POLR2K protein abundance is significantly associated with the RNA expression of many other genes, with 6,019 significant associations in total. LSCC shows the largest number of these associations.

The most reproducible POLR2K-associated genes across cancer lineages are CSF3R, WDR74, and CD180. Each is linked with POLR2K in more than 3 cancer types. Because this analysis shows association rather than direction, both POLR2K-to-partner and partner-to-POLR2K results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, POLR2K versus CSF3R in PDAC, with a Pearson correlation of -0.45.
